Jane or Joan Thwaites was buried in All Saints Churchyard, Batley, Metropolitan Borough of Kirklees, West Yorkshire, England

family

She married Lionel Copley 1435, son of Richard Copley and Margaret Denton. He was born ABT 1410, and died BEF 28 MAY 1508.

Their son John Copley b: ABT 1444 in Wighill, Yorkshire married 1 Anne Pigot b: ABT 1461

ANNE PIGOT, married before 7 Nov. 1485 JOHN COPLEY, Esq., of Batley, Yorkshire, son and heir of 'Lionel Copley, Esq., of Batley, Yorkshire, by Joan, daughter of John Thwaites, of Lofthouse, Yorkshire'. He was born about 1444 (aged 64 in 1508). They had four sons, John, William, Knt., Adam, Esq., and Lionel, and six daughters, Margaret (wife of ___ Saltmarsh), Mary (wife of John Portington), Anne, Joan (or Jenett), Isabel, and Elizabeth (wife of ___ Snydall). JOHN COPLEY, Esq., left a will dated 22 Dec. 1509, proved 9 Jan. requesting buried in the church yard of Batley near his parents. His wife, Anne, survived him.

  • XI. THE WILL OF JOHN COPLEY, ESQ., OF BATLEY.
    • [Reg. Test. viii. 28 a and 230 b.]
  • Dec. 22, 1509. John Coplay* of the parishe of Batlay. To be buried in the church garth of Batlay nye my fader & moder. To on vyse makyng on Estur daie in the mornyng to the sepulcre iij s. iiij d. All the landes which my fadir 'Lionell Coplay' hath given to my too breder, Richard & Herry, with my consent & grant, them to have it duryng their lyves. To my wif her joyntre with her dowrie duryng her lyff. To William Coplay, my yonger son, Warmefeld, Snydall, Hillome, and Potirton duryng hys liff. To the mariage of ich of my iiij doghters, Anne, Jenett, Isabell, and Elisabeth, c marc, so that the marie & be guyded after the feoffers & myn executores. To Jane Portyngton, doghter of John Portington my sonne in lawe, xx li. To Mr. Thomas Coplay, my broder, an ambelyng horse which I rode upon myself. To my broder Richard an ambelyng horse. To my broder Herry+ on gray trottyng horse.
  • * A few notices of the family of Copley of Batley may be of value. In vol. iv. pp. 46-50 are the wills of the testator's grandfather and uncle.
  • 'Lionel Copley, the testator's father, according to the Visit'n of 1684, married Joan dau. John Thwaites of Lofthouse ; or, according to Mr. Hunter, Jane d. Thos. Thwaites of Denton (South Yorkshire, i. 51). On May 26, 1508, the will of Lionel Copley of Batley, esq., was proved (not copied) at York, and adm. was granted to Henry Copley, his ex'r. (Reg. Test. vii. 37 a.)'
  • The testator married Agnes, dau. of Sir Geoffrey Pigot of Clotherham near Ripon, and she and her children are mentioned in the wills of her mother (Test. Ebor. iv. 6) and of her brother (Ibid. 213). The testator made a feoffment of his estates on Dec. 20, 1st Hen. VIII., which is appended to his will. The feoffees were "Thomas Wortlay knyght, John Norton th'elder, knyght, John Norton the yonger, esquyer, Herry Vavasor of Hesilwod, Thomas Lynlay of Lynlay, Thomas Sothill, Christofer Eltoftes of Rishworth & Herry Seyvell esquyeres, & Richard Coplay and Robert Herrison gentilmen." The directions are already specified in the will.
  • + On Dec. 16, 1511, he makes his will :Herry Coplay, gentilman, par. Batley. To be buryed in the kirk yerd of Batley at the feet of my brother, John Coplay, lately departyed, neyr my fader & moder, of whos soulys God have mercy. My best horse, on saddill, etc., oon swerd, for my mortuarie. To Wm Copley, my nevew, oon rede satten dublet. To my neyce Anne Copley oon fether bed. Rawfe Savell. I will y't all such goodes, as rystes in my lady my suster's handes of myne uncle William's bequestes, go to the execucion of my will. To my nece Agnes Flemyng oon girdill. To my broder Richard my chalice. My nevew John Copley, my brother Richard Copley, and John Browne my ex'rs. [Pr. 22 Apr. 1512.] (Reg. Test. viii. 91 a.)
